Capital market regulator Securities and Exchange Board of India (Sebi) has issued show causes notices (SCNs) to the National Stock Exchange (NSE) and 14 individuals as a part of probe against the exchange in the ‘unfair access’ controversy.
Among those issued the SCNs include former chief executive officers (CEOs) Chitra Ramkrishna and Ravi Narain. The former had unexpectedly quit NSE in December 2016, while the latter currently serves as the vice-chairman on NSE’s board. Other individuals to have received the Sebi SCN are some officers in the technology and business operations department.
